访问远程MySQL数据库服务器有几种方法,可以根据不同的需求选择合适的方式:
- 使用MySQL命令行客户端:MySQL命令行客户端是MySQL官方提供的一个交互式终端工具,通过它可以直接连接和管理MySQL数据库服务器。使用命令行客户端连接远程数据库服务器的方法如下:
- 使用MySQL命令行客户端:MySQL命令行客户端是MySQL官方提供的一个交互式终端工具,通过它可以直接连接和管理MySQL数据库服务器。使用命令行客户端连接远程数据库服务器的方法如下:
- 参数说明:
<远程服务器IP地址>
:远程MySQL数据库服务器的IP地址;<端口号>
:MySQL数据库服务器监听的端口,默认为3306;<用户名>
:远程MySQL数据库服务器的用户名;-p
:连接时需要输入的密码。- 例如,连接远程MySQL数据库服务器的命令可以是:
- 例如,连接远程MySQL数据库服务器的命令可以是:
- 在连接成功后,即可在命令行客户端中执行各种MySQL操作,如查询数据库、执行SQL语句等。
- 使用图形化工具:除了命令行客户端,还可以使用一些图形化工具连接和管理远程MySQL数据库服务器,如Navicat、MySQL Workbench等。这些工具提供了直观友好的界面,能够简化数据库的操作和管理。
- 连接远程MySQL数据库服务器的步骤一般为:
- 打开图形化工具;
- 新建数据库连接;
- 输入远程服务器的IP地址、端口号、用户名、密码等连接参数;
- 点击连接按钮,连接到远程数据库服务器。
- 连接成功后,可以通过这些图形化工具进行数据库的操作、数据的导入导出、表的设计等。
- 使用编程语言的MySQL驱动:如果需要通过编程语言来访问远程MySQL数据库服务器,可以使用相应编程语言的MySQL驱动。常用的编程语言如Java、Python、PHP等都有相应的MySQL驱动库,通过连接字符串、用户名、密码等参数,可以实现远程数据库的连接与操作。
- 以Java为例,可以使用JDBC(Java Database Connectivity)来连接远程MySQL数据库服务器。首先需要下载并导入MySQL的JDBC驱动包,然后通过以下代码连接远程数据库服务器:
- 以Java为例,可以使用JDBC(Java Database Connectivity)来连接远程MySQL数据库服务器。首先需要下载并导入MySQL的JDBC驱动包,然后通过以下代码连接远程数据库服务器:
- 需要注意的是,连接字符串中的
<远程服务器IP地址>
、<端口号>
、<数据库名>
、<用户名>
、<密码>
需要替换为实际的连接参数。
这些方法可以根据实际情况选择,访问远程MySQL数据库服务器需要确保网络通畅,且远程MySQL数据库服务器已正确配置允许远程访问的权限。对于云计算领域,腾讯云提供了云数据库MySQL(https://cloud.tencent.com/product/cdb-mysql)产品,可用于搭建高可用的MySQL数据库集群,并提供了丰富的管理和监控功能。